I'm a producer of handmade natural and cruelty-free cosmetic for everyone including shaving solids, body butter, foot cream, hand and body lotion, bath melts, roll on-fragrance, and so much more. Almost all of my items are vegan -- the only one that is not quite yet is my lip balm, but a vegan version is on its way! Creating new products is my favourite part of my practice, so I'm in “the lab” regularly with a view to expanding my line of products. For example, I’m almost done testing my new basic hold hair styling gel and I’m getting close to a deodorant stick I love! Yay!

The reason I started doing this was two-fold. First, the discomfort my partner was beginning to experience as a result of his growing chemical sensitivity alerted us to very real problems with the petro-chemical cosmetics industry. Second, the unfairly inflated prices of many natural products were starting to grate on us. Related to that was the unfair labelling practices of many companies, especially after being acquired by larger, multi-national corporations. Why were they including contested ingredients such as SLS or propylene-glycol in their formulations, but still calling them natural alternatives?  We figured we could either keep spending more and more and more toward finding better products, or I could start making our own. We chose the latter ;-)
